Terraviz: Working With Big Data Using Unity

Abstract

We believe that to have an impact on society, data should be easy to find, access, visualize and understand. Built using the Unity game engine, TerraViz is designed to facilitate this process by visualizing information from the past, present, and future. The goal is to ingest big data and convert that information into efficient formats for real-time visualization. Designed for a world where everything is in motion, TerraViz allows fluid interaction across 4D time and space, providing a tool for the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ration’s (NOAA) vast collection of information. This presentation will cover displaying various types of data in Unity at a global scale, visualizing regional information in “geo-located scenes” including coastal flooding or volumetric cloud structure, and developing environmental simulations such as exploring the ocean floor in a remotely operated vehicle.
